Regeneron Pharmaceuticals Associate Director, Business Analytics in Sleepy Hollow, New York

Known for its scientific and operational excellence, Regeneron is a leading science-based biopharmaceutical company based in Tarrytown, New York that discovers, invents, develops, manufactures, and commercializes medicines for the treatment of serious medical conditions. Regeneron commercializes medicines for high LDL cholesterol, eye diseases, oncology, atopic dermatitis, asthma, and chronic rhinosinusitis with nasal polyps and has product candidates in development in other areas of high unmet medical need, including pain, rare diseases, and infectious diseases.

We are seeking an Associate Director, Business Analytics. This role will support Cardiovascular Business Unit through the application of end-to-end analyses and insights, and the application of analytical expertise to drive strategic choices, tactical execution, and commercial excellence. This is a hands-on analytical role that is proactive, collaborates across functions, and enables data-driven decisions that are based on rigorous analyses, best available information, and business knowledge. The Associate Director, Business Analytics will collaborate on the rare disease data strategy, the procurement of various datasets, building and implementing the analytics plan, informing business decisions, and designing and implementing analytical solutions to support business opportunities. This position will also conduct primary and secondary market research and provide integrated insights for the business unit.

In addition to strong analytics skills, the Associate Director, Business Analytics should have excellent communication skills, a demonstrated track record of effective business partnership, business impact and influence.
